Laws of Motion formulas to remember

These formulas are not enough by themselves, but they are essential for solving chapter-based questions quickly and accurately.

Topic Formula / Relation Use case
Newton's Second Law F = ma Basic force-acceleration relation
Impulse J = Δp Force acting for a short time
Friction f ≤ μN Static and kinetic friction problems
Momentum p = mv Collision and motion analysis
Action-Reaction For every action, there is an equal and opposite reaction Two-body force interactions

How to prepare Laws of Motion smartly

A good strategy is to mix concept revision, formula revision, and question practice. That is the fastest way to improve accuracy in this chapter.

What to do

  • Start with Newton's laws and free body diagrams
  • Revise friction formulas and their conditions
  • Practise connected body and pulley questions
  • Solve previous year questions before moving to mocks

What to avoid

  • Do not memorise formulas without understanding force direction
  • Do not skip friction and pseudo force questions
  • Do not ignore FBD drawing practice
  • Do not move to mocks before solving chapter questions
